Web9) Today, there are five subspecies of tiger. These subspecies are the Bengal tiger, South China tiger, Indochinese tiger, Sumatran tiger and Amur tiger (also known as Siberian tiger).Sadly, three subspecies of tiger have become extinct – the Caspian, Bali and Javan. 10) Less than 100 years ago, tigers could be found throughout Asia.
